Jack Karczewski QC

Jack Karczewski QC is the Deputy Director of the Office of the Director of Public Prosecutions in Darwin, Northern Territory.

Background

Jack was first admitted as a solicitor in Queensland on 19 December 1974. He moved to Papua New Guinea in 1975 where he was employed by the PNG Government in the Public Prosecutors Office as a Crown (later State) Prosecutor. In October 1980 Jack became employed by the Port Moresby City Council as its Principal Legal Officer.

Jack moved to the Northern Territory in 1984 to practice criminal law and enjoy a tropical lifestyle. From June 1984 to December 1993 he was employed as Crown Prosecutor with the Prosecutions Division of the NT Department of Law (later ODPP).

From December 1993 to November 1997 Jack was employed as a Policy Law Officer in the Policy Division, NT Attorney General’s Department. He returned to the ODPP in 1997 to take up the position of Assistant Director in Darwin.

Jack was appointed Deputy Director of the Office of the Director of Public Prosecutions in June 1998.

Jack has been a member of the NT Council of Law Reporting since its inception in 1992. He was elected as special member’s (DPP) representative on the NT Bar Council in March 2000 and has been a member of the Executive Committee of the Criminal Lawyers Association of the Northern Territory since its inception in 1986.

Jack was a council member of the Law Society Northern Territory from 1997-1998. He was a member of the Allocations Committee of the Law Society Public Purposes Trust from June 1997 to June 1999.

He was commissioned as an Officer in the Royal Australian Air Force Specialist Reserve (Legal) on 28 April 1987 and promoted to A/WGCDR rank and appointed to the position of Panel Leader for the 13 SQN Panel with effect from 1 November 1999.
